Wednesday, March 15 NBA Player Props
Russell Westbrook Under 18.5 Points + Assists (-115) (Bet $115 to collect $215)
*Best Odds Available at DraftKings*
Clippers head coach Tyronn Lue has finally arrived at the same conclusion that many of us did weeks ago: The Russell Westbrook experiment is not going to work.
Westbrook hasn't logged a single fourth-quarter minute in each of the Clips' last two games. And his last four games with Kawhi Leonard and Paul George are what really set off alarms. Russ is averaging 13.3 points + assists in just 27.0 minutes per game over his last four contests with Kawhi.
Most importantly, the usage is not there for the former MVP. He's only taken 8.8 field goal attempts and 1.5 free throw attempts per game during this stretch. And he's posting just 5.5 assists on 10.0 potential assists per game during this stretch. It's becoming clear that Russ won't be one of LA's primary offensive creators moving forward, and these lines likely won't be this high much longer.
Klay Thompson Over 21.5 Points (-120) (Bet $120 to collect $220)
*Best Odds Available at FanDuel*
It took him a while to get going, but Klay Thompson has been an offensive juggernaut over the last few months. Whether playing with Stephen Curry or without him, Klay's production has been incredible.
Klay has cashed this over in 27 of 39 games since December 1st, averaging 24.9 PPG. And he's still hit the over in 13 of 19 games alongside Steph Curry during this stretch. In five games since Curry's return from his most recent injury, Thompson has scored at least 22 points in four of these five contests, averaging 23.8 PPG.
The 6-foot-6 splash brother has an 80% hit rate over his last ten games, which is just too good to pass up. He's shooting the lights out right now, and this is a great spot to back him for a primetime showdown against the Clippers.
DeMar DeRozan Over 23.5 Points (-110) (Bet $110 to collect $210)
*Best Odds Available at BetMGM*
The Chicago Bulls have struggled this season, but they're now in must-win territory. Only 15 games are remaining on Chicago's schedule, and they're currently tied with the Wizards for the 10-seed in the Eastern Conference. And they face the Sacramento Kings' 26th-ranked defense this evening. It's a perfect storm for DeMar DeRozan.
With the Bulls at home, this game has just a 1-point spread. Given how desperate the team is and the increased likelihood of a close game, we should see a heavy workload for DeRozan. He's putting up 25.0 PPG this season, but that skyrockets to 28.3 PPG in games where he plays at least 36 minutes.
DeMar has played 36+ minutes in 31 games this season. He's scored at least 23 points in 24 of them. In a fast-paced, high-scoring game, everything points toward a 25-plus-point outing from the 6-time all-star.
